Transaction 542d3298922d297d590ecae8251c38fe44bc647e0094d4ec66736f90c6df8932
1 Input
1 Output
-
542d3298922d297d590ecae8251c38fe44bc647e0094d4ec66736f90c6df8932:0
- value
- 313508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cab446fe7757d2a8814133a63e7ad3fcfb767434 OP_EQUAL
- address
- 3LApPBUBNMccwobup1VdDc9byAfdnp6ZGQ